Web app development is making waves in the present marketplace. Even though applications have been around for a significantly long time, they are getting to be imperative over the long haul and the two organizations, and customers acknowledge how essential it is for them.
This is the reason every association is quick to build up a web-based business using a web app to make an impact online. This way has intensified the interest of designers and their abilities. However, one difficulty that engineers face is about the platform they should use for app creation.
Since there are various platforms accessible for web-based application development, the decision isn't in every case clear. Luckily, one platform you can choose to ensure you're going the correct way is Angular. This framework previously showed up in 2009 is an open source web application platform.
It was created by Google alongside an individual community of engineers and is about HTML, CSS, and JS. While this framework is utilized for apps by just 18.55% of the business and industry class, websites, for example, Google, Sony PS3, and YouTube use it as their primary platform.
The Angular is ideal when you need to make a dynamic web app because it causes you in expanding the HTML vocabulary by actualizing features amid runtime and making the code progressively neat for quick development.
Considering all, since you know precisely how prominent the Angular is, so below we collected 7 point which shows you why to choose Angular programming language for your next project. And we also considered some of the world famous websites which are designed using Angularjs
Angularjs Development Minimizes the need to write code
A typically misguided judgment which encompasses engineers is that they adore writing code and can go through their time on earth doing it. While the facts confirm that programmers do win a fair living by writing code, not every person is partial to it.
With Angular, you can get the edge off because, with its rich list of capabilities, it makes development simpler because it diminishes the need to write code. Since it utilizes an MVC architecture, it isn't as complicated as others, and you don't have to write endless lines of code to actualize the data models.
Also, because mandates aren't a piece of the app code, Angular makes it feasible for other parallel working groups to deal with the framework.
Customizable with mandates
Since Angular utilizations HTML as its example language, it makes utilization of mandates to design new punctuation and includes code information regarding the respected conduct. This is a star for the platform because these mandates make it feasible for you to concentrate on creating logic that will enable you to work all the more productively and effectively.
Also, by changing the conduct of the HTML labels, you'll be creating customized labels and reusing them to make the code progressively discernible. This predominant element, when utilized accurately, can help you not just in developing a glitch-free web app, but likewise, one that doesn't set aside a great deal of opportunity to make.
Simpler to discover help with large community
Maybe one of the especially favorable circumstances of working with Angular is its generous community support. The framework is supported up with individuals from the center development group, just as the individuals who contribute because they're searching for some fixes or need to recommend a couple of minor improvements for the framework.
This large community is valuable to the customer since it encourages them to find the best development services for their app and is ideally appropriate for engineers since it offers a few arrangements and online resources.
Angular is famous to the point that gatherings are held worldwide, and it is even examined at hackathons. The community gives an opportunity to clients and engineers alike to associate with one another and locate the ideal responses to every one of their necessities.
Utilizations MVC Architecture for development
Like we previously clarified, the Angular uses MVC architecture for developing individual web apps. The MVC abbreviation represents the Model View Controller and makes app creation so a lot easier. This example parts application logic, data, and see and once you do that, whatever is left of the activities will be dealt with by Angular.
Offers channel flexibility
You should likewise consider seeking after and utilizing Angular to build up your next web app is because it gives excellent channel flexibility. Concerning an app, a channel helps in refining the incentive before showing the outcome.
Regardless of whether it's changing over a string to capitalized or changing the decimal spot of a number, channels will enable you to remain over the amusement. These channels work as independent features which are committed to data transformations. Additionally, not exclusively would you be able to utilize the previous channels given by the framework, but likewise, make your own.
Utilizations a particular strategy
Another advantage of utilizing the Angular framework to build up a web app is that you can make it by joining separate modules. When you split the whole app into different modules, you enhance the app's architecture as well as improve its flexibility and usefulness.
The modules you make will rely upon one another or be autonomous, as indicated by your inclinations. The systematic method will help in improving the work processes, and efficiency, so better outcomes are accomplished inside a brief timeframe.
At last, while each element of the Angular is as essential as the other, one which you can't overlook is the testing stage. No application is finished without testing, and if you need to make sure that you're giving your customers a blunder free app, it is something you'll have to invest energy and exertion on.
When you place parts of the apps inside the framework modules, they wind up simpler to control, and this split enables you to stack the services which require testing separately. Also, because the whole app that is worked with Angular is connected by reliance infusion, you can easily infuse the example data into the controller and measure the yield amid testing.
Let’s have a look at the world four most websites which are designed using AngularJs
YouTube is known for its Video Streaming and broadcasting.
It is the most well-known video sharing platform which is possessed by Google. It is the most massive traffic website on the planet.
Individuals can communicate by creating a free channel and offer their video worldwide.
Its worked with Angular JS parts. All the more specifically, YouTube's PlayStation 3 app is constructed altogether with AngularJS.
Approx Traffic in November 2017: 24 Billion
Yahoo is progressively known as a search engine and related specialist co-op platform like email, News, messenger and so forth.
They are utilizing the Node.js as the first technological stack for the server side development.
Where do they use Nodejs?
Reid Burke – Sr. Programming engineer at Yahoo clarifies:
" We have made Hosted apps and Websites using the programme which helps us to achieve massive traffic" According to stats in 2017 they reach around 5.43 Billion users attendance
Amazon.com | Nodejs ( 2.91 billion)
Amazon is universes most great web-based business website with 300 M+ dynamic users worldwide.
The primary motivation to pick node.js for some core segments of the website is cutting edge.
Amazon has presented Alexa an AI-based framework that encourages its customers to shop online utilizing voice direction.
Nodejs has an occasion-driven, non-blocking I/O display.
It is appropriate for Alexa as it has trigger based information and it is one of the most significant biological communities of open source libraries on the planet.
Alexa can work consistently with Nodejs and AWS Lambda to deal with the trigger based occasion.
Approx Traffic in November 2017: 2.91 Billion
Netflix is a new pattern that is assuming control over conventional Television.
In the time of comfort, it gives video-on-request to the users as per their requirements at whatever point and wherever.
It is one of the world's largest online media streaming suppliers conveying right around 7 billion hours of recordings to about 50 million customers in 60 nations for every quarter.
According to statista.com, Since the development and extension of its streaming administration, Netflix has gathered a vast number of streaming subscribers worldwide.
As of the central quarter of 2017, Netflix has nearly achieved the 100 million imprints for streaming subscribers, in this manner dramatically increasing its supporter numbers from the beginning of 2014.
Why Netflix Implemented the Node.js?
Yunong Xiao, Principal Engineer, Netflix says,
"We loved execution that Node.js offers. From a 40 minute + startup time they went to under a moment."
Approx Traffic in November 2017: 1.7 Billion